Product Description:
Ganglioside GM1 is widely used in neuroscience research due to its role in neuronal function and development. It is a key component of cell membranes in the brain, particularly in lipid rafts, where it influences signal transduction and cell communication. GM1 is studied for its potential therapeutic applications in neurodegenerative diseases like Parkinson's and Alzheimer's, as it promotes neuronal survival and repair. Additionally, it is used in studies exploring its ability to bind toxins, such as cholera toxin, making it valuable in immunology and vaccine research. GM1 also plays a role in understanding cellular mechanisms related to cancer and autoimmune disorders.
